    Quote Originally Posted by Dzian View Post
    Why blizzard one ever. It's generally only low level filler for a slow mp tick.

    Blizzard is a 2.5 cast. Blizzard 3 is a 3.5 cast. So yeah it's a second slower. But Umbria ice 3 slashes your fire 3 cast time in half. Umbral 1 doesn't.
    So where you lose a second on blizzard 3 you gain 1.75 seconds on fire 3.

    Casting blizzard 3 then is a gain of 0.75 seconds over blizzard 1
    Thats a very common misconception. F3 on UI3 might have a faster cast time, but you *still* have to wait one GCD. It takes the same time to cast the next spell after a B1 as it takes for a F3 under UI3 or even swiftcasted. You don't gain any seconds by choosing one or the other.

    So yes. B1 still has its uses, albeit small.

    Quote Originally Posted by KaivaC View Post
    I wonder why Flare has a shorter cast time when in UI3. Feels similar to the trap with MNK and how often Tornado Kick is up.
    Flare is a Fire spell, that's why.

    UI3 has a special trait that allows all fire spells to be cast in half their regular cast time. Its main purpose is to serve as a fast way to swap between your UI3 and AF3 stances.

    All of the rotations I see appear more or less accurate and helpful. I will sat one thing I didn't see or notice was a good place to use Foul. Ideally you want to use Foul right after entering Umbral Ice, swiftcasted or otherwise. This way it allows for your MP to regenerate without using any. This is especially useful when you Transpose after ising Flare, as while in Umbral Ice I the MP refresh is slower, so using Foul allows you to build up more MP.
